npm 是 Node.js 的包管理工具,使得前端开发变得更加高效和规范。而 tweed-env 是一个 npm 包,它提供了开发环境的配置和优化,以及一些常见问题的解决方案。本文将介绍 tweed-env 的使用教程,旨在帮助前端开发者更好地进行项目开发和优化。
安装 tweed-env
在使用 tweed-env 前,需要先安装它。在终端中运行以下命令即可:
npm install tweed-env --save-dev
这里使用 --save-dev
参数是因为 tweed-env 只用于开发环境。
安装完成后,在项目的 package.json
文件中,可以看到 tweed-env 已经被添加到 devDependencies
中。
使用 tweed-env
tweed-env 的主要功能是为开发环境搭建提供帮助,具体而言,它包含以下部分:
tweed-env.js
:开发环境的入口文件,包含了一些优化配置和代码规范;postcss.config.js
:PostCSS 的配置文件;babel.config.js
:Babel 的配置文件;webpack.config.js
:Webpack 的配置文件。
下面是一个简单的 tweed-env 的配置示例:
-- -------------------- ---- ------- ----- -------- - --------------------- -------------- - ---------- -- ---------- ------------- - ------ --- ----- -------- ----------------------- -- ---
在以上代码中,我们使用了 tweedEnv
函数,通过传入一个对象,来为开发环境进行配置。其中 customConfig
对象是一个可选的参数,它允许我们添加一些自定义配置,比如网站标题和 favicon 图标。
在使用 tweed-env 前,我们还需要在项目根目录下创建一个 public
目录,并添加一个名为 index.html
的文件,在该文件中,我们一般会添加如下的内容:
-- -------------------- ---- ------- --------- ----- ----- ---------- ------ ----- ---------------- --------- ----------- ----- ------------- ----- ---------------------------- ------- ------ ---- --------------- ------- -------
上述代码中,我们设置了网站标题和 Favicon 图标,并设置了一个空的 div
元素作为 Vue 或 React 等框架的挂载点。
示例代码
下面是一个使用 tweed-env 的示例代码:
-- -------------------- ---- ------- ------ ----- ---- -------- ------ -------- ---- ------------ ------ --- ---- -------- ---------------- ------------------ ---- -- -------------------- ------------------------------ --
在该代码中,我们使用 React 和 ReactDOM 来创建一个应用,并将其渲染到 id
为 app
的 DOM 元素上。
总结
通过本文的介绍,我们学习了使用 tweed-env 来优化前端开发环境的方法。该工具包含一些常见的配置和优化,可以帮助我们更好地进行项目开发和优化。如果你遇到了一些常见的问题,可以尝试使用 tweed-env 来解决。希望本文能够对大家的项目开发有所帮助。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005553681e8991b448d2677